Wellness center creates program for seniors

MCCORDSVILLE — A new, free program for seniors is starting up at Hancock Wellness Center in McCordsville. Senior Social Wednesdays will create fun, informal gatherings from 10 to 11 a.m. every Wednesday, with regular themes throughout the month.

The first Wednesday of the month will be “Captivating Kids,” in which seniors will be paired up with Jungle Club kids; the second Wednesday will be “Sensational Speakers,” with Hancock County Senior Services program director Kit Paternoster stepping up to the plate in March; seniors will try low-impact exercises during “Make a Move” the third Wednesday of the month; and the fourth Wednesday will be themed “Fascinating Food Facts.”

All activities are planned for the first 15 to 20 minutes of the hour with the remaining time for casual conversation. Refreshments will be provided.
